What are Touring Tires?

Tire manufactures introduced these touring tires just recently and so far they have gained various reviews from car owners and drivers. The counterpart of touring tires are the all-season tires and don’t be surprised if these two kinds of tires are always compared.

In terms of providing level of comfort to drivers, car owners, and passengers, touring tires are satisfying. This is what makes them distinct from their counterpart and the kind of performance touring tires feature is far better than the one of a regular tire model.

When it comes to high speed handling, again, touring tires are your best shot. The smooth ride that you are aiming for as you hit the road will be given to you. Although not as high performing as the all-season tires, touring tires will satisfy if you are after better traction when driving. Where do you usually see touring tires? Touring tires are best fitted for luxury cars. If you are driving a minivan or an SUV, you will find it more comforting to equip your car with touring tires. Car owners and drivers who are required to be on frequent road trips should settle for touring tires to have the safe ride. And if you are concerned about the costs, you may think twice in acquiring touring tires because they are expensive. The superior tread wear comes with a cost but you get benefited for up to 60,000 to 80,000 miles of warranty.

What are All-Season Tires?

You have been given an overview about what all-season tires have to offer. As the name suggests, all-season tires are best when you want to be comfortable and assured in driving during the four seasons of the year. You can overcome the hurdles on the road during the summer season, the winter season, the snow season and the rainy season with your all-season tires. Plus, you can have a high speed handling for both smooth handling and rough handling on the road. People living in areas that are frequented by snow and winter conditions equip their cars with all-season tires.

All-season tires have become a hit and a favorite because of their specific features and offerings. Though both have unique features that the market demands, it will be better to settle with a set of tires that will equip your car in all seasons of the year while giving you invaluable performance.
